Katharina von Kellenbach
Katharina von Kellenbach was born in Stuttgart, Germany in 1960, studied Evangelical Theology in Berlin (West) and Goettingen and entered the graduate program in religion at Temple University in Philadelphia, USA in 1983. Her dissertation (1990) on Anti-Judaism in Feminist Religious Writings has been published with Scholars Press (now Oxford University Press) in 1994. She is currently an Associate Professor of Religious Studies at St. Mary's College of Maryland, a public liberal arts college in the United States.
